Presbyterian and Methodist Child Care Service

In 1971, the Methodist Department of Childcare merged with the Presbyterian Department of Social Services to create the Presbyterian and Methodist Child Care Service. Graeme Gregory was the Director. Share Care

Share Care was established in 1983 in Abbotsford as a small, community based foster care program servicing the City of Yarra. Share Care arranged respite, emergency and longer-term care and accommodation for children in the homes of approved caregivers. Goulburn Valley Family Care

Goulburn Valley Family Care Inc. was established in Shepparton in 1984 to provide non-government, non-profit services to families throughout the Goulburn Valley region. In the late 1990s it became the major provider of family services for the West Hume region. Marian Lodge Training Centre

Marian Lodge Training Centre was established by the St John of God Brothers. It was adjacent to St John Of God Training Centre in Cheltenham. Marian Lodge catered for boys described as having moderate intellectual disabilities and being unable to follow a special schooling program, but able to benefit from other training.

Christian Brethren Family Care Inc.

Christian Brethren Family Care came into being in 1968. From 1969, it ran Bethany family group home in Box Hill North. In the late 1970s, Christian Brethren Family Care closed the family group home and concentrated on its Temporary Emergency Care program. Forest Hill Residential Kindergarten

The Forest Hill Residential Kindergarten opened in 1960. It provided short-term residential care for up to 20 children, and day care for smaller groups of children, aged 2 – 6 years during times of family stress or breakdown. Glenelg Foster Care

Glenelg Foster Care was established in 1983 by Lutheran Children’s Homes. The Lutheran Church had decided to move its child care services from cottage homes in eastern Melbourne, to foster care services in the Glenelg region in south western Victoria. Community Connections (Vic) Ltd

Community Connections came into being in 1998. Previously, it was known as the South Western Community Care Association Inc, which was founded in 1991. It had offices in Warrnambool, Geelong, Hamilton, Colac, Camperdown and Portland. This organisation ceased operations in 2012.

Ministering Children’s League, Victoria Branch

The Ministering Children’s League was a British organisation founded in 1884, with branches operating globally and across Australia. The League conducted charitable work, such as supporting, fundraising for, and running various institutions such as hospitals, respite/convalescent homes, and children’s homes.
